Abstract

The invention provides a conformal paint coating shielding method of a circuit board, comprising the following steps: manufacturing a shielding rubber sleeve according to circuit board products of different types; and in the process of spraying and coating, sheathing the shielding rubber sleeve on certain parts, incapable of being sprayed, of the circuit board for shielding, wherein the shielding rubber sleeve is made of anti-static rubber, and can be prevented from generating static electricity in the plugging and pulling process and further damaging electrostatic-sensitive devices on the circuit board, and the rubber sleeve is in an elastic design, is made of high-temperature-resistant inertial rubber, does not generate reaction and bonding with a conformal paint, and can be repeatedly used. The conformal coating shielding method is more suitable for devices in complex shapes of the circuit board, the electrostatic hazards can be eliminated, the efficiency is high, effective shielding can be formed, the spraying quality can be effectively guaranteed, the control is easy, and the repeated use of the rubber sleeve ensures that the cost in actual production is lowered.

Background technology
Wiring board in use, may be in the different environment, such as chemical substance (fuel, cooling agent etc.), vibrations, high dirt, salt fog, moist and high temperature etc., so wiring board can produce the problems such as burn into softens, is out of shape, goes mouldy, and causes the wiring board circuit to break down.Three anti-lacquers are a kind of coating of special formulation; three anti-lacquers are coated on the surface of wiring board; form the diaphragm (three prevent referring to protection against the tide, anti-salt fog, mildew-resistant) that one deck three is prevented; diaphragm can protective circuit be avoided infringement under the environment such as chemistry, vibrations, high dirt, salt fog, humidity and high temperature; improve the reliability of wiring board, increase its coefficient of safety.
Various circuit board products need to cover some positions of the circuit board that can not spray paint in the process of coating of spraying paint, and do not need the position that applies to prevent that three anti-lacquers are coated in, and can reduce the results of use of radiators such as heat dissipation for circuit board device coating three anti-lacquers.The position that does not need to apply has: heat dissipation for circuit board device, base, potentiometer, insurance, button, charactron, high-power resistance, lock body, connector etc.
The patent No. is CN101474613A, open day be July 8 in 2009 day, be called the patent of invention of " lacquer spraying technique of product ", put down in writing in its claims: " step 1, paster: the position that product does not allow to spray paint is covered with paster; ", " step 7, lower tool: will take off from the oil spout tool through the product of oil spout, unload plug and tear gummed paper operation ".In the middle of the gummed paper bonding process, need to the shape of gummed paper according to different components, cut into one, one again bonding.Gummed paper and device will have certain bonding firmness, effectively cover guaranteeing, after coating is complete, need to peel off removal, easily produce static in the process of peeling off, and are a kind of potential harm to circuit board.And peel off finish after because the viscosity of gummed paper can stay sicker on the surface of crested, need to use alcohol to clean sicker, these measures wastes man-hours, efficient is low, protection effect is poor.In addition, the quality of gummed paper bonding will directly have influence on the quality of coating, and wayward.Because screening effect is bad, the quality problems that cause repeatedly occur.
The patent No. is CN2822785Y, open day be October 4 in 2006 day, be called " clamp for shielding use during paint-spraying ", this patent discloses a kind of easy-to-dismount spray paint shield mould, its technical scheme is in actuating arm by External Force Acting, it is actuating arm generation strain, thereby realize that plug connector separates with being fixed in of retainer, finish the shielding function of painting process, because its actuating arm elastic deformation level is limited, and for the device that concaves relatively difficulty apply external force, its screening effect can be affected.
The patent No. is CN201197977Y, open day be February 25 in 2009 day, be called " clip type spray paint shield mould ", this patent discloses the mould that a kind of inboard is provided with grab, the mode that this mould hooks together with grab is engaged on to be with on the product that sprays paint, and covers non-painting zone.Although this mould convenient operation, dismounting is simple, and screening effect is not good, for complex-shaped device, and its Design of Dies operating difficulties.
Summary of the invention
In view of the above-mentioned prior art problem that masking methods exists when three prevent spraying paint, the object of the present invention is to provide a kind of circuit board three anti-lacquer coating masking methods, the method is more suitable for wiring board complicated shape device, can eliminate electrostatic hazard, efficient is high, can form effectively to cover, and can effectively guarantee the quality of spraying paint, be easy to control, and use the method can reduce the cost in the actual production.
For achieving the above object, the technical scheme taked of the present invention is as follows:
A kind of circuit board three anti-lacquer coating masking methods, described masking methods may further comprise the steps:
(1) according to shape, the size of circuit board institute mounting related components, determine to cover size and the shape of gum cover, make and cover gum cover.
(2) will cover the position that gum cover is enclosed within does not need to apply three anti-lacquers;
(3) circuit board surface is carried out dust removal process;
(4) coating three anti-lacquers;
(5) circuit board is toasted processing;
(6) gum cover is covered in dismounting, in order to reusing;
The described preparation material that covers gum cover is antistatic rubber, and described antistatic rubber comprises that silicon rubber or natural rubber add carbon black.
An again preferred version of the present invention is: said antistatic rubber sheet resistance is 1 * 10 4-3 * 10 4Ohm
Of the present invention again take preferred version as: the described gum cover that covers is as Flexible Design.
Of the present invention again take preferred version as: the described preparation material that covers gum cover is as keeping the inertia rubber of superperformance under 50-80 ℃ bad border.
Of the present invention again take preferred version as: the described preparation material that covers gum cover is as keeping the inertia rubber of superperformance under 70 ℃ bad border.
Owing to having adopted technique scheme, beneficial effect of the present invention is as follows:
1, the inventive method can form and effectively cover, and the quality of spraying paint improves
Because this method is according to the different product device characteristics, makes the rubber gum cover of various shapes, is enclosed within on the device, form a kind of covering, this rubber gum cover wall thickness is about 1~1.5mm, and is flexible, three anti-lacquers are difficult for infiltration, can form effectively device and cover, and have greatly improved the quality of spraying paint.
2, eliminate electrostatic hazard
This rubber gum cover designs for antistatic, and adopting silicon rubber or natural rubber to add carbon black is that the rubber gum cover prepares material, so the inventive method is eliminated the potential hazard that static exists circuit board components.
3, but rubber gum cover Reusability reduces production costs
This rubber gum cover is high temperature resistant inertia rubber, can not form reaction with the mildew resistance polyurethane paint that uses in the actual production, and can under 70 ℃ hot environment, keep premium properties, but so this rubber gum cover Reusability, reduce production costs.
4, production efficiency is high
The inventive method is covered a circuit board the most complicated, can finish in 1 minute, has greatly improved production efficiency, is conducive to the Industry Promotion of this inventive method.

Specific embodiment
Below in conjunction with accompanying drawing, the inventive method is conducted further description:
Embodiment 1:
As shown in Figure 1, cover gum cover according to geometry, the size making of radiator on the circuit board, before coating, to cover gum cover and be enclosed within on this radiator, then apply three anti-lacquers, and cover gum cover and play screening effect, guarantee that this radiator is not subject to the pollution of three anti-lacquers, radiating effect is unaffected.
Embodiment 2:
As shown in Figure 2, gum cover is covered in geometry, size making according to digital display module on the circuit board, before coating, to cover gum cover is enclosed within on this digital display module, then apply three anti-lacquers, cover gum cover and play screening effect, guarantee that this digital display module is not subject to the pollution of three anti-lacquers, do not react with three anti-lacquers, thus the display effect of assurance digital display module.
Embodiment 3:
As shown in Figure 3, gum cover is covered in geometry, size making according to AMP socket on the circuit board, before coating, to cover gum cover and be enclosed within on this AMP socket, then apply three anti-lacquers, and cover gum cover and play screening effect, guarantee that three anti-lacquers can not rise on the pin because of capillarity, guarantee that the device pin on the socket can be owing to the pollutions of three anti-lacquers, and cause and the socket pins insulation, affect the product conduction property.
